Support patient rehabilitation and independence in a dynamic healthcare environment located in Gower, MO. This role assists Occupational Therapists in delivering therapy treatments aimed at enhancing patients’ mobility and overall physical health. The position is contract-based, offering the opportunity to contribute meaningfully to patient care while gaining valuable experience.

Responsibilities include:

  • Assisting patients in performing exercises and following treatment plans tailored to their needs
  • Monitoring and documenting patient progress to ensure effective recovery
  • Encouraging and motivating patients throughout their rehabilitation journey
  • Supporting injured individuals in improving motor skills to facilitate return to work
  • Teaching patients with disabilities strategies for greater independence
  • Updating patient records and maintaining thorough documentation for the Occupational Therapist
  • Ensuring treatment areas and equipment are organized and well-maintained
  • Educating patients, families, and caregivers on techniques to support ongoing therapy at home
